EDA hears request for track base work; Choctaw Nation donation account proposed as fund source

Pittsburg County Economic Development Authority · December 15, 2025

During new business Dec. 15 the Pittsburg County EDA discussed adding a 4-inch base of 1½-inch crusher run to the track; Vice-Chairman Ross Selman raised the need and Chairman Charlie Rogers suggested using the Choctaw Nation donation account. No formal action was recorded.

Vice-Chairman Ross Selman told the board during new business that the track needs a 4-inch base of 1½-inch crusher run.

Chairman Charlie Rogers suggested the board consider using the Choctaw Nation donation account as a potential funding source for the work. The minutes record the suggestion but do not show a motion, vote, or timeline for the repair; no formal action was recorded at the meeting.

The discussion was noted under the meeting’s new-business item; the minutes do not specify a cost estimate, a contractor, or a target date for completing the work. Any follow-up, budget allocation, or procurement steps would need to be brought back to the board for formal consideration and recorded in future minutes.
